Does a Round Table Change Conversations?

Ordinary choices often hide invisible systems.

Yes. Round tables reduce hierarchy and increase eye contact. The hidden mechanism is conversational symmetry.

Furniture quietly shapes social behavior.

Round tables remove head positions and distribute attention more evenly among participants.

The hidden mechanism is conversational symmetry.

People think tables hold meals. Often, they shape relationships.
